{"uuid": "ce2fb9c0-6c77-465b-b791-f114043e855c", "vulnerability_lookup_origin": "1a89b78e-f703-45f3-bb86-59eb712668bd", "author": "2a075640-a300-48a4-bb44-bc6130783b9b", "vulnerability": "CVE-2025-2263", "type": "published-proof-of-concept", "source": "https://t.me/DarkWebInformer_CVEAlerts/7425", "content": "\ud83d\udd17 DarkWebInformer.com - Cyber Threat Intelligence\n\ud83d\udccc CVE ID: CVE-2025-2263\n\ud83d\udd25 CVSS Score: 9.8 (cvssV3_1,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H)\n\ud83d\udd39 Description: During login to the web server in \"Sante PACS Server.exe\", OpenSSL function EVP_DecryptUpdate is called to decrypt the username and password. A fixed 0x80-byte stack-based buffer is passed to the function as the output buffer. A stack-based buffer overflow exists if a long encrypted username or password is supplied by an unauthenticated remote attacker.\n\ud83d\udccf Published: 2025-03-13T16:25:59.356Z\n\ud83d\udccf Modified: 2025-03-13T16:29:58.290Z\n\ud83d\udd17 References:\n1. https://www.tenable.com/security/research/tra-2025-08", "creation_timestamp": "2025-03-13T16:45:18.000000Z"}
